Researchers analyzed gas from 30 landfills across the United States and found #PFAS contamination at every single site.

Their data suggest that landfills nationwide may collectively emit nearly a ton of PFAS into the air annually.
www.thenewlede.org/2025/11/land...
US landfills emit nearly a ton of airborne PFAS a year, study finds
US municipal landfills leak roughly 1,800 pounds of PFAS into the air annually — evidence that the country’s garbage dumps are a persistent source of airborne “forever chemicals,” according to a new n...

Good news: World’s largest chemicals group, BASF, will phase out #PFAS by '28. US-based Ecolab will exit PFAS by '26 -nervous investors & financial risk after 3M fiasco. Chemours & Solvay closed plants this year in France, but not in U.S. (Chemours trying to expand in NC)
chemsec.org/worlds-bigge...
World's biggest chemicals group to exit PFAS 'forever chemicals'
BASF will phase out PFAS by 2028. This decision signals a new trend among chemical giants to phase out “forever chemicals".
